A.Dear client,
The Court in Appabhai vs. State of Gujarat [AIR 1988 SC 696], held that if one were to examine the meaning of showing the middle finger, it is sexual in nature along with the other remarks of the accused so it constitutes the offenses of sexual harassment and intention to outrage the modesty of the woman under Sections 354 A and Sections 509 respectively.
